Studio Access - Independent Pottery Practice (not taught)

 

Studio Access sessions are designed for potters who want time and space to work independently on their own projects.
 

Who Studio Access Is For

Studio Access is available to:

  • Students who have completed our 6-week Introduction to Pottery course

  • Those who have attended a 1-1 throwing workshop

  • Those who have completed at least two of our other courses

If you are an intermediate or advanced potter, or have taken beginner lessons elsewhere, you are also welcome - please contact me before booking.

A studio induction is required for all users and, if new to the studio, an informal assessment of experience may be needed to ensure you are confident using materials, tools, and equipment safely.

 

Session Details & Pricing

  • £30 for 2.5 hours

  • Packages of 10 sessions (25 hours) and 20 sessions (50 hours) also available to book with a discount applied.

  • Sessions must be booked as a 2.5-hour block, not split across a couple of days or the week.

  • Additional time can be added at £10 per hour. This can be used at any time on the same day.

  • Maximum 8 participants per session

  • Currently 5 pottery wheels available, with plenty of space for hand-building and decorating
     

What’s Included

  • Use of pottery wheels, hand-building space, tools, and glazing facilities

  • All studio tools, studio glazes (12+), and regular kiln firings. Kiln is always operated by studio owner

  • Stoneware clay for personal practice and development by hobbyist and improver potters. There is no fixed weight limit per session; however, use is subject to a reasonable fair-use policy in the context of shared studio access.

  • Additional clay available to purchase at supplier price
     

Support & Teaching

These are not taught sessions and there is no formal lesson plan.

I will be present in the studio and happy to offer occasional advice. However, if it becomes clear that you require ongoing teaching or significant support, an additional charge will apply. Studio Access is intended for independent practice.

Facilities
There are 5 pottery wheels and plenty of space for hand-building or decorating. I would encourage anyone who is interested in pottery to practice with different techniques to gain experience.

2 large workbenches for handbuilding
Slab roller
5 pottery wheels
Glazing area, with ample studio glazes
Large number of tools
Ample shelving for storage
Tea and coffee making facilities
Fridge
Toilet on-site
